Delving into Biometric Voice Authentication Technology
Biometric voice authentication technology has emerged as a powerful tool for safely verifying user identity. This innovative approach leverages the unique features of an individual's voice to verify their identity. Unlike traditional methods that rely on passcodes, which can be commonly forgotten or compromised, biometric voice authentication provides a more trustworthy and accessible experience. During the procedure, the user's voice is captured and then compared to a stored template. The system assesses the similarity between the current voice sample and the template. If a strong level of correlation is detected, authentication is successful.
- Several factors contribute to the accuracy of biometric voice authentication technology. These include the complexity of vocal characteristics, such as pitch, tone, and rhythm.
- Advanced algorithms are implemented to analyze the audio data and distinguish unique voice patterns.
- Additionally, environmental conditions can also influence the accuracy of the system.
Biometric voice authentication offers a wide range of deployments across multiple industries. From financial transactions to medical record access, this technology is rapidly being adopted to improve security and convenience.
